BPTES anti-TCR Its implication in endometrial bleedingSelective, allosteric non competitive inhibitor of glutaminase 1 (GLS1), selective for GLS1 over GLS2, glutamate dehydrogenase, and ? glutamyl transpeptidase, consequently inhibiting glutaminolysis. Useful agent for immunometabolism research.
